#8301d3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#8301d3 is composed of 51.4% red, 0.4%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.9%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 277.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 41.6%. #8301d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#0700a7.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

● #8301d3 color description : Strong violet.
The hexadecimal color #8301d3 has RGB values of R:131, G:1,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:1,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 8585683.
